# Splitgate assignment service — production env file.
# Owner: experimentation platform team at Corvane.
# Do not reorder blocks; the deploy script diffs this file line by line.
# ASSIGN_MODE stays "sticky" in prod; "random" is for load tests only.
# EXPERIMENT_CACHE_TTL is seconds; keep under 300 or bucket drift appears.
# Rotate the bucketing secret every release cut and update staging first.
# The current bucketing secret is set on the next line.

env line for fawip-fajef: COURIER_KEY13=6b302cb20dc80

Heads up, future maintainers: the Parityhawk crawler for hotel rate comparisons was scraping our sandbox instead of the live rate feeds because someone copied `checker.env` from the demo box. Symptoms: every property shows perfect parity, which should've been the first red flag. I've fixed the base URL and crawl cadence, but the feed credential still needs re-adding since the sandbox one got committed and revoked. The live feed secret belongs on the line right after this note.

sealed setting: LEDGER_TOKEN13=5d842615a26d7

Subject: Dedupe service 4.2 cut for review

Release channel: Quellmark's alert deduplicator build is frozen for security review. Changes: suppression window now signed, merge keys hashed before storage, no plaintext pager payloads retained. No new external dependencies. Review scope is the fingerprint module only. Rollback path verified on staging. The trace token for this candidate build appears below.

session token of kageg-tahop = htk14_af3c1ccccb7dcf

## Changelog — Ticktrace 1.9

### Renamed: DRIFT_API_TOKEN
During the cron drift investigation we found plugins confusing this variable with the metrics token, so it has been renamed to indicate it authorizes drift-report uploads specifically. Plugin authors must read the new name from 1.9 onward; the old name is ignored without warning. Sample env files in the SDK are updated. In your deployment env file, the drift-report upload secret is set on the next line.

env line for fawef-taguf: VAULT_KEY13=a9695905a9a90